The Evolution of Korea: A Journey Through History, Culture, and Modernization
Korea's identity has been shaped by countless years of history, marked by periods of unity and division, intrusion and independence, development and tradition. From its ancient beginnings to the quick modernization seen in the 20th and 21st centuries, the evolution of Korea is a complex tale of durability and change.
Historical Foundations
The Ancient Kingdoms
Korea's history dates back to around 2333 BCE, with the famous founding of Gojoseon by Dangun Wanggeom, a figure rooted in misconception. This early kingdom laid the groundwork for the abundant tapestry of Korean civilization. Subsequently, the Three Kingdoms Period (57 BCE-- 668 CE), defined by the kingdoms of Goguryeo, Baekje, and Silla, experienced considerable developments in culture, politics, and trade. This era fostered developments in metalwork, agricultural practices, and Buddhism, which played a pivotal function in unifying the Korean people.
The Goryeo and Joseon Dynasties
Following centuries of warfare and political combination, the Goryeo Dynasty (918-1392) emerged, providing Korea its name. The Goryeo duration is noted for its cultural achievements, consisting of the creation of movable metal type. After Goryeo, the Joseon Dynasty (1392-1910) developed a Confucian state that emphasized education, literacy, and ethical governance. This dynasty produced significant cultural turning points, consisting of the development of Hangul-- the Korean alphabet-- by King Sejong the Great.
The Shadows of Division
Japanese Occupation (1910-1945).
The dawn of the 20th century brought troubled modifications. Korea dealt with Japanese imperial guideline from 1910 to 1945, a duration marked by severe oppression, cultural assimilation, and economic exploitation. The struggle for independence during this time galvanized nationwide identity, with movements and uprisings leading the way for post-war freedom.
The Korean War (1950-1953).
The end of World War II saw Korea divided at the 38th parallel into 2 zones of impact-- the Soviet-backed North and the U.S.-supported South. This department caused the Korean War, a terrible dispute that solidified the split into 2 distinct nations: North Korea (DPRK) and South Korea (ROK). The war's after-effects left a tradition of militarization, stress, and contrasting governance systems.
South Korea's Economic Miracle.
The Rise of Industrialization.
In stark contrast to its northern equivalent, South Korea went through an exceptional improvement from the 1960s onward, frequently called the "Miracle on the Han River." Under successive governments, particularly throughout the authoritarian program of Park Chung-hee, South Korea focused on fast industrialization and economic growth. This resulted in the development of international corporations (chaebols) such as Samsung, Hyundai, and LG.
Democratization and Societal Change.
The battle for democracy started in earnest in the 1980s, culminating in the democratization motion of 1987. This duration saw substantial strides towards civil liberties, flexibility of expression, and political pluralism. As South Korea transitioned from an authoritarian program to a vibrant democracy, cultural and social modifications did the same, including broadening ladies's rights and cultivating a varied civil society.
Cultural Renaissance and Global Influence.
Hallyu: The Korean Wave.

From K-dramas and K-pop to Korean cuisine and fashion, Korea's cultural exports have actually gathered a huge worldwide following. Artists and groups like BTS, BLACKPINK, and Parasite (winner of the 2020 Academy Award for Best Picture) have actually showcased Korea's imagination on the world phase, increasing interest in its culture and language.
Tech and Innovation.
South Korea is likewise known for its technological advancements, marked by its role as a leader in telecoms, electronic devices, and robotics. The nation boasts some of the fastest internet speeds internationally and is home to cutting-edge business driving innovation in various fields, consisting of synthetic intelligence and biotechnology.
The Resilience of North Korea.
A Different Path.
In contrast, North Korea has followed a significantly different trajectory. Governed by a regime that prioritizes military expenditure and rigorous control over details, North Korea has faced numerous difficulties, consisting of financial difficulties and humanitarian crises. Regardless of these difficulties, the program maintains a strong national identity, greatly concentrated on Juche, or self-reliance, which shapes the nation's political and economic strategies.
Conclusion: The Future of Korea.
As Korea moves forward, it stands at a crossroads where its rich historical tradition fulfills the pressures and chances of modernization. While South Korea continues to prosper as a global cultural powerhouse, North Korea remains shrouded in secrecy and isolation. The prospect of reunification remains a subject of speculation, marked by both hope and hesitation.
Eventually, the evolution of Korea advises us of the durability of its individuals and the power of cultural identity in the middle of changing times. Korea's journey is not simply a national story; it is a testament to the human spirit's capability to adapt, innovate, and aspire for a better tomorrow.
